Caustics in the Grassmann Integral
Abstract
It is shown that a simple model of 2N-Grassmann variables with a four-body coupling involves caustics when the integral has been converted to a bosonic form with the aid of the auxiliary field. Approximation is then performed to assure validity of the auxiliary field method(AFM). It turns out that even in N=2, the smallest case in which a four-body interaction exists, AFM does work more excellently if higher order effects, given by a series in terms of 1/N1/3 around a caustic and of 1/N around a saddle point, would be taken into account.
